Kering is the parent company to 12 renowned, global luxury fashion and jewelry brands, each with its own unique and creative expression. As a Group, Kering promotes “freedom within a framework”, ensuring each brand has autonomy to drive their business strategies independently while offering a platform of shared services to support different stages of business size and scale. What we do is as important as how we do it; we care and we dare, and our mission is to be the most influential luxury group in the world in creativity, sustainability, and economic performance.
About Kering Technologies
Kering Technologies is the Kering Group division that provides the smartest solutions for our cross-brands services. In particular, the Kering Technologies division handles all the activities concerning the company’s Management Information System Development in order to link the business’s needs to the company’s IT infrastructures. HOW YOU WILL CONTRIBUTE
- As part of the Global IT Warehouse & Logistics team, you will be the AMER technical point of contact for the IT projects and activities in your logistics and warehouse perimeter, acting as focal point for logistics partners and Houses
- Supporting the evolution of processes, applications and systems for logistics and warehouse operation and the integration with Kering Technologies echo-system
- Being the project coordinator for AMER new initiatives by identifying key delivery milestones, collaborating with project leaders and implementing required action plans
- Gathering and monitoring the change requests by analyzing business and operational requirements and writing detailed functional specifications.
- Reacting quickly to record and support all Warehouse Management incidents and recommend action plans for effective problem solving
- Collaborating in the creation of a more agile and innovative Group culture
- Guaranteeing the correct use and respect of Kering Technologies processes and the right adoption of the solutions by delivering specific training to regional key users
WHO YOU ARE
- A professional with 7+ years of wide experience in IT Warehouse and Logistics projects, preferably in an international context (Consumer Goods or Luxury and retail industry will be considered as a plus)
- An application delivery expert, able to partner effectively with stakeholders, elaborating business requirements and implement solution leveraging on Vendor/Partner.
- Knowledgeable about B2B and B2C warehouse management business and operational processes
- Proficient with every step of the Warehouse Management process from receiving and inventory to order management and shipping
- Knowledgeable of Warehouse Automation (Dematic) and Reflex (WMS) and Stealth/SAP ERP packages is a plus
- A person highly organized, a critical-thinker able to work with tight deadlines
- Excellent English oral and written skills
- Knowledge of Italian and/or French is a plus
- Graduate in Engineering and/or Computer science is a plus
